# Define how to send the "Fresh Coffee!" announcements.
# Format "Senders: Configurations: Settings"
#
# Copy relevant sections from here to file `notify.yaml`
#
# Each "configuration" can send notifications with one protocol to a single
# channel, but from multiple clients (agents). It is possible to send messages
# to several channels by defining multiple configurations. Use "test" as the
# test client ID, or "*" for all the clients. Verify message sending works (to
# "test" clients) by running `python test_sending.py`.
senders:
pushover1:
clients: [<comma separated list of clients>]
protocol: pushover
token: <pushover.net API token>
user: <pushover.net user name (delivery group)>
title: Fresh Coffee!
message: Fresh Coffee!
hipchat1:
clients: [<comma separated list of clients>]
protocol: hipchat
server: <server ip/dns name>
token: <API token>
roomid: <room id>
message: Fresh Coffee!
color: yellow
slack1:
clients: [<comma separated list of clients>]
protocol: slack
token: <API token>
channel: <channel name>
message: Fresh Coffee!
color: <good|warning|danger|hex color code>
influxdb1:
clients: [<comma separated list of clients>]
protocol: influxdb
server: <server ip/dns name>
port: 8086
user: <influxdb user name>
password: <influxdb user password>
database: <database name>
measurement: <measurement name>
machine: <name for the coffee machine (tag)>
